With no time to stamp this is the outside and inside of 2 identical cards I did a few weeks ago: Basic design is from the SU 2006-2007 catalog. Sentiment is from Verses Rubber Stamp Company; Chinese calligraphy - All Night Media; other images: Stampin' Up. Moss and cranberry cardstock, ribbon from SU; the Asian coins will be available in the store in a few days. Brown archival ink from Ranger; floral spray colored in with su markers: pretty in pink, ruby red, mellow moss. My Stampin' Up markers are fraying horribly. I purchase a new set every year - my current set is from July, 2006. The felt quality of the brushstroke tips is just not what it has been in years past...I resorted to ordering a bunch of Copic markers from A Muse Art Stamps, and the balance of my Copic marker needs from http://www.carpediemstore.com (thanks Otter~!) - they are 50% off retail currently! Copic markers are professional grade and will hopefully be an improvement over the SU marker disappointment. But, then again, the Copic ones are twice as much as SU (full retail)...like my mom said, 'most of the time you get what you pay for.' We'll see how Copic holds up - would love to hear of others' experience with the Copic brand if time permits.
